WebHeight and decline of imperial Rome Domitian was succeeded by an elderly senator of some distinction, Marcus Cocceius Nerva (96–98). Among the beloved rulers of Rome that succeeded him were Trajan (reigned 98–117), Hadrian (117–138), Antoninus Pius (138–161), and Marcus Aurelius (161–180). Together these are known as the Five Good …

"This... WebAt the height of its power in the 1st and 2nd centuries AD, the Roman Empire consisted of some 2.2 million square miles (5.7 million sq. km). A population of 60 million people (or as much as 1/5 of the world's population at that time) claimed citizenship of Rome, and as many as 120 million people may have lived within the borders of the Empire during this … how to extract honey without damaging comb
